The surname Cortabarra has origins in Spain and Uruguay, where it is relatively uncommon compared to other surnames. In this article, we will explore the history, meaning, and distribution of the surname Cortabarra in these two countries.
The surname Cortabarra is of Spanish origin and is believed to have originated in the northern regions of Spain. It is a compound surname, with “corta” meaning “cut” or “short” and “barra” meaning “bar” or “rod” in Spanish. The combination of these words suggests a possible occupational or locational origin for the surname.
One theory is that the surname may have been derived from a place name, possibly referring to a location with a short or cut bar or rod. Another possibility is that it may have been an occupational surname for someone who worked with bars or rods, such as a blacksmith or metalworker.

In Spain, the surname Cortabarra is relatively rare, with an incidence of 127 according to available data. This suggests that the surname is not widely distributed across the country, but is nonetheless present in certain regions.
The distribution of the surname Cortabarra in Spain may be more concentrated in specific areas, such as the northern regions where it is believed to have originated. Families with the Cortabarra surname may have roots in these areas, reflecting the history and migration patterns of their ancestors.
Compared to Spain, the surname Cortabarra is even rarer in Uruguay, with an incidence of 1 according to available data. This indicates that the surname is not commonly found in the country, making it a unique and distinctive name for those who bear it.
Despite its limited distribution, the Cortabarra surname may have been brought to Uruguay through migration or other historical factors. Families with this surname in Uruguay may have connections to Spain or other regions where the name is more prevalent.
